Types of Car Keys
Car keys can be found in numerous styles, with each type featuring special performances. Here are the most common kinds of car keys:
Traditional Car Keys: These are basic metal keys with no electronic parts. They can quickly be replicated at any locksmith professional or hardware store.
Transponder Keys: Introduced in the late 1990s, transponder keys include a chip that interacts with the car's ignition. If the correct key isn't utilized, the car will not begin.
Remote Key Fobs: These keys come with built-in remote controls that allow users to lock and unlock their automobiles from a distance. Some remote fobs also integrate transponder technology.
Keyless Entry Systems: These advanced systems enable chauffeurs to unlock and begin their cars without physically inserting a key. Instead, the vehicle utilizes proximity sensing units to acknowledge the key fob.
Smart Keys: These are the next generation of keyless ignition systems that require the key fob to be in close proximity to the vehicle for operation. They offer boosted security features and benefit.

If you find yourself in need of a car key replacement, it is vital to follow a methodical procedure to ensure you get the best key effectively. Here are the actions:
1. Determine the Type of Key
The very first step in key replacement is to identify which kind of key you have, as this affects the replacement procedure and cost.
2. Examine for Spare Keys
If you own a spare key, this can considerably lower replacement expenses. Inspect your home or speak with member of the family to see if anybody else has a spare.
3. Contact Your Car Dealership or Locksmith
You have two primary choices for replacement:

FAQs about Vehicle Car Key ReplacementQ1: How much does it cost to replace a vehicle key?
A1: The expense of changing a car key can differ significantly based on the key type, the vehicle make and design, and whether you pick a dealership or locksmith professional. On average:
Traditional key: ₤ 5 - ₤ 15Transponder key: ₤ 75 - ₤ 150Remote key fob: ₤ 100 - ₤ 300Smart key: ₤ 200 - ₤ 500Q2: How long does a car key replacement take?
A2: The replacement time can vary. Conventional keys can be duplicated rapidly, while transponder, remote, and wise keys may take longer due to programs requirements, usually within 30 minutes to a number of hours.
Q3: Can I configure a new key myself?
A3: Some cars enable owners to program brand-new keys themselves, however many modern-day cars need specific tools or software, making it suggested to speak with an expert.
Q4: What should I do if my key gets stuck in the ignition?
A4: If a key is stuck in the ignition, try turning the guiding wheel slightly while turning the key. If this does not work, speak with a mechanic or locksmith to avoid damage.
Q5: Is there a method to replicate my key without the original?
A5: Duplicating a car key without the original can be challenging, especially for advanced keys. In such cases, a locksmith can often create a replacement key by cutting a brand-new one from the vehicle's lock or ignition cylinder.
